As India eyes setting up its own space station by 2035, the Indian Space Research Organisation (ISRO) has proposed to the industry to collaborate with it Read More…
As India eyes setting up its own space station by 2035, the Indian Space Research Organisation (ISRO) has proposed to the industry to collaborate with it Read More…
©2024 Bharatshakti